CBS 2011-2012 Fall Schedule

MONDAY
8/7c How I Met Your Mother
8:30 pm: 2 BROKE GIRLS
9 pm: Two and a Half Men
9:30 pm: Mike & Molly
10 pm Hawaii Five-0

TUESDAY
8 pm NCIS
9 pm NCIS: LA
10 pm UNFORGETTABLE

WEDNESDAY
8 pm Survivor
9 pm Criminal Minds
10 pm CSI [new time slot]

THURSDAY
8 pm The Big Bang Theory
8:30 pm HOW TO BE A GENTLEMAN
9 pm PERSON OF INTEREST
10 pm The Mentalist

FRIDAY
8 pm A GIFTED MAN
9 pm CSI: NY
10 pm Blue Bloods

SATURDAY
8 pm Rules of Engagement [new time slot]
8:30 pm Comedy Encores
9 pm Drama Encores
10 pm 48 Hours Mystery

SUNDAY
7 pm 60 Minutes
8 pm The Amazing Race
9 pm The Good Wife [new time slot]
10 pm CSI: Miami

CBS' scripted shows for the 2011/2012 season:

One-hour

CSI - 12th season
CSI: Miami - 10th season
NCIS - 9th season
CSI: New York - 8th season
Criminal Minds - 7th season
The Mentalist - 4th season
The Good Wife - 3rd season
NCIS: Los Angeles - 3rd season
Blue Bloods - 2nd season
Hawaii Five-O - 2nd season
The 2-2 - 1st season
A Gifted Man - 1st season
Person of Interest - 1st season
Unforgettable - 1st season

Half-hour

Two and a Half Men - 9th season
How I Met Your Mother - 7th season
Rules of Engagement - 6th season
The Big Bang Theory - 5th season
Mike & Molly - 2nd season
2 Broke Girls - 1st season
How To Be a Gentleman - 1st season

CBS' scripted shows cancelled in the 2010/2011 season:

One-hour

Medium - 7 seasons (5 on NBC and 2 on CBS)
Chaos - 1 season
Criminal Minds: Suspect Behavior - 1 season
The Defenders - 1 season

Half-hour

Mad Love - 1 season
Shit My Dad Says - 1 season
